transactable / Dockerfile
Matis082's picture
Add pyaudioop fallback, force rebuild
c4ed31c
raw
history blame contribute delete
329 Bytes
FROM python:3.12-slim
WORKDIR /home/user/app
# Install audioop fallback for safety
RUN pip install --no-cache-dir \
gradio==4.44.0 \
httpx>=0.28.0 \
pyaudioop
COPY app.py .
RUN useradd -m -u 1000 user
USER user
EXPOSE 7860
ENV GRADIO_SERVER_NAME="0.0.0.0"
ENV GRADIO_SERVER_PORT="7860"
CMD ["python", "app.py"]